A radiant system is an advanced heating and cooling solution that delivers superior indoor comfort by circulating heated or chilled water through a network of pipes installed within floors or ceilings.
Unlike traditional HVAC systems that rely on air circulation, radiant systems transfer energy directly to surfaces and occupants, creating a more natural and consistent indoor environment.

This diagram of a typical commercial radiant cooling system illustrates two installation configurations: REHAU CCTC (Concrete Core Temperature Control) in the upper floor and a standard in-slab construction with an insulation barrier in the lower floor.
Supply lines from the energy source are colored red; return lines are colored blue.

In radiant cooling systems, RAUTHERM S pipe is either integrated into a floor structure with insulation to condition the space above or without insulation to condition the space above and below.
Designing and installing a radiant cooling system can be straight forward, especially when integrating with a radiant heating system. A focus on controlling humidity levels and water temperatures is essential to reduce the risk of condensation associated with radiant cooling.
Radiant cooling works best in a tightly sealed building, so you will typically need supplemental ventilation, either to meet the building's fresh air requirements or to meet peak cooling loads. A controlled ventilation system, such as the REHAU ECOAIR™ ground-air heat exchanger, is ideally compatible with radiant cooling because it preconditions fresh air with geothermal energy, reducing demand on the cooling system.
